Makers Workshop

Cradle Country, TAS

Makers Workshop in Burnie on Tasmania's north-west coast celebrates the region's creative and industrial heritage through interactive displays and hands-on workshops. Visitors can try papermaking using traditional techniques, explore exhibitions about local creative industries, and browse handcrafted works by Tasmanian artisans in the retail gallery.
